Transaction 25db29b570c219cc226a124d598c81b9588da9f60d21afc1c728d5d0754e2296

1 Input
2 Outputs
  • 25db29b570c219cc226a124d598c81b9588da9f60d21afc1c728d5d0754e2296:0
  • value  174000
    address  1AEvmycpKXfLYS57D6GsPE9Ac3hcguZoDJ
  • 25db29b570c219cc226a124d598c81b9588da9f60d21afc1c728d5d0754e2296:1
  • value  12883342
    address  3CZbP7K8GgTdupuxijqHg6AsfQK3SuzbHt